Description

Cheyenne narratives exhibit all possible orders for the three major constituents of subject, object, and verb. In this book, the author explores factors that could possibly influence the order of major constituents in Cheyenne narrative. Through the analysis of texts elicited from Cheyenne speakers, she concludes that the newsworthy first principle provides an accounting for alternate constituent order and can be used to predict constituent order. Cheyenne, an Algonquian language, is spoken by Native Americans living in Montana and Oklahoma. The author has done language research with those in Montana since 1975. The theoretical basis of this study comes from her work toward earning a master's degree at the University of Oregon.
